This element specifies a point in time during the podcast that can be linked to directly and optionally supplemented with additional content. This element specifies a point in time during the podcast that can be linked to directly and optionally supplemented with additional content.
`start` is required and uses the [Normal Play Time](https://www.w3.org/TR/media-frags/#naming-time) standard. `start` is required to identify the starting point of the chapter within the podcast. Start time is expressed as seconds since the start time of the podcast.
`title` is optional and is used as a user facing identifier for this chapter `title` is optional and is used as a user facing identifier for this chapter
`href` is optional and points to additional user facing content `href` is optional and points to additional user facing content
`type` is optional but it is strongly encouraged if `href` is used so that clients can handle the chapter content appropriately `type` is optional but it is strongly encouraged if `href` is used so that clients can handle the chapter content appropriately
